在当今互联网信息爆炸的时代,网页内容瞬息万变,如何快速、准确地获取网页快照成为许多开发者和企业的刚需。基于此,网页快照截图API应运而生,提供了便捷、高效的网页快照服务,极大地简化了网页信息获取与存储流程。本文将全面探讨高效网页快照截图API的价值意义、核心优势、使用便捷性,并为您奉上详细的使用教程以及售后说明。特别章节中,将重点解析使用时的注意事项及安全提示,助您安全高效地驾驭这一技术利器。
网页快照截图API通过程序接口将网页内容实时转换为图片或PDF等格式,方便后续查看、存档、分析与展示,具有极强的实用价值。
选择一个高效的网页快照截图API,不仅仅是功能的堆砌,更是性能优化和用户体验的综合体现。以下优势,显著区别良莠:
高效API的另一个关键指标是易用性。一般提供丰富的文档支持与样例代码,无论是前端还是后端,均能快速接入:
访问API供应商官网,完成注册。登录后进入控制台,创建应用并生成唯一API密钥。密钥是调用接口的身份验证凭证,请妥善保管。
import requests
api_endpoint = "https://api.screenshotprovider.com/v1/capture"
api_key = "YOUR_API_KEY"
params = {
"url": "https://www.example.com",
"format": "png",
"width": 1280,
"height": 720,
"delay": 2
}
headers = {
"Authorization": f"Bearer {api_key}"
}
response = requests.get(api_endpoint, params=params, headers=headers)
if response.status_code == 200:
with open("screenshot.png", "wb") as f:
f.write(response.content)
else:
print(f"Error: {response.status_code} - {response.text}")
许多API支持滚动截取完整页面、模拟用户行为(如点击、登录),以及图片水印嵌入等功能,可根据需求灵活运用。
优质API服务商除了提供产品,更会为用户提供全面的技术支持与保障:
答:429状态码表示请求过于频繁,超出API速率限制。请调整调用频率,或者联系服务商申请更高限额。
答:部分高级API支持模拟登录操作或提供Cookies传递方式,具体需查看接口文档或咨询客服。
答:合理设置加载延迟参数,确保页面动态内容加载完成。还可以结合截图前的页面检测逻辑,提高准确率。
答:多数高效截图API支持自定义分辨率,甚至可截取完整滚动页面。此外,导出为PDF格式也是常见功能之一。
答:大部分服务商按调用次数或流量计费,也有免费额度或试用版本。具体价格政策请查看官方资费说明。
网页快照截图API作为现代互联网技术的重要工具,极大简化了网页内容抓取与存储的难题。选择高效、稳定且安全的API,不仅能提升工作效率,更保障了数据安全性。希望本文的详尽解析与实用教程,能帮助您顺利上手,发挥API的最大潜力,实现业务智能化升级。
最近更新日期:2026-03-16 04:43:50